Transaction 6851efded1048fb8440ae8fb644e1cab8efacdcb68afb9e94afc53395e094bfa

1 Input
2 Outputs
  • 6851efded1048fb8440ae8fb644e1cab8efacdcb68afb9e94afc53395e094bfa:0
  • value  7700000
    address  3Fw12GeT1GyUpP8cRji6JWF8txkWxmqo9b
  • 6851efded1048fb8440ae8fb644e1cab8efacdcb68afb9e94afc53395e094bfa:1
  • value  480576458
    address  3KHwNPCoLLPhqVnaaCJ3A8gMaUixvdMnC7